Tier 1: Edge Security & CDN

Global Anycast routing integrated with cloud-native Web Application Firewalls (WAF) and automated DDoS mitigation. SSL/TLS termination occurs at the edge to cache static assets close to end-users.

Public Perimeter

Tier 2: Ingress Control & Routing

Redundant, Multi-AZ Application Load Balancers (ALB) passing traffic to an API Gateway. Manages rate limiting, JWT validation, and semantic microservices path routing.

DMZ / Public Subnet

Tier 3: Orchestrated Microservices

Isolated private subnets running containerized clusters (EKS/GKE) across independent fault domains. Internal service-to-service communication is enforced via mutual TLS (mTLS) within a service mesh.

Private Subnet

Tier 4: High-Availability Data Tier

Multi-Region replicated transactional databases configured with active-passive auto-failover, backed by a distributed, memory-optimized Redis layer for low-latency session caching.

How do continuous CI/CD pipelines prevent production crashes?

Pipelines isolate runtime builds into temporary staging environments to run automated unit validation testing arrays, code syntax checks, and vulnerability scans before allowing rollout execution steps into live production instances.
